In this article, we will follow some solutions to turn off and on the phone without the power button.
1. Turn off and on the phone without the power button on iPhone
1.1. Turn off the screen, turn off the power with accessibility (Assistive Touch)
Step 1: You open Setting (first) => Accessibility (2).
Step 2: You choose item Touch (first) => AssistiveTouch (2).
Step 3: You turn the AssistiveTouch switch to turn on (first) => Customize control menu (2).
Step 4: You touch any button (first) => change to function Lock screen (2) => Accomplished (3).
– To lock the screen:
You touch AssistiveTouch (first) => choose Lock screen (2).
– To turn off the power:
You touch AssistiveTouch and hold the virtual key Lock screen within five seconds until the power off screen appears.
1.2. Turn off screen with back touch gesture (iPhone 8 and later models only)
Step 1: You enter Setting (first) => Accessibility (2).
Step 2: You choose Touch (first) => Touch the back (2).
Step 3: You choose Double tap (first) => Lock screen (2).
Step 4: To turn off the screen in this way, tap the back of your iPhone twice with your finger to turn off the screen.
Note: Thick phone cases will affect the sensitivity of this feature or not.
1.3. Power off iPhone in settings
Step 1: You open Setting (first) => General settings (2).
Step 2: You scroll down and select Shutdown. After that, the power off screen will be displayed for you to operate.
1.4. Turn on iPhone screen without power button
To light up the iPhone screen, we can use the . key Home (applies to iPhone 8 and earlier, SE/SE 2020) instead of the power key.

2. Turn off and on Android phone without power button
2.1. Turn off the phone screen on the Action Center (Action Center)
Some phones such as Xiaomi, Vsmart … are integrated with a shortcut to lock the screen by swiping from the top of the screen to the bottom.
To turn off the screen this way, tap and swipe from the top edge of the screen to open the Action Center. If you don’t see the option to lock the screen, swipe the small line (first) Scroll down to expand => Lock screen (2).
2.2. Turn off phone screen with Assistive Touch app

2.3. Unlock the screen with a lift gesture or double tap the screen
Some phone models of Xiaomi, Huawei … are equipped with this feature to help users conveniently unlock the phone without the power key.
Step 1: You open Setting => Lock screen (first) => flip the switch to turn on with feature Pick up to wake up (2).
With this feature, the phone after locking the screen can be turned on by holding the phone and tilting it slightly upwards or picking up the phone from a flat surface.
If your phone supports the feature Double tap the screen to wake up then turn it on. When your phone is locked, you just need to tap the screen twice and the screen will light up for you to manipulate and use.
2.4. Light up the screen using fingerprint sensor/face recognition
Some Android models turn on the fingerprint sensor, the face is always open, and we can use this sensor to light up the screen. The implementation is quite simple and applicable to most Android smartphones equipped with a fingerprint sensor that is, you just need to touch the fingerprint sensor position to open the screen and if that fingerprint is successfully recognized, the phone will unlock and access the home screen.
3. Plug in the phone charger to turn on the phone without the power key
This method can be applied to iPhone and some Android phones. If the power button is broken and the device is in a state of power off, you can plug in the charger to power on and turn on the device. And if the phone is in screen off mode, plugging in the charger will help the screen light up and you can operate on the screen.
